Drake and Future receive one of the worst second week drops in hip hop history with #WATTBA

Drake Future 6All summer, there were rumors of Drake and Future coming together for a joint project. The two finally joined forces for their collaborative mixtape, What A Time To Be Alive. With the mixtape out, it was released via retail and debuted to major numbers.

Early predictions had What A Time To Be Alive at 500,000 copies sold in its first week. Actual numbers were closer to 339,000, more than enough to be number one. But, the second week was not as friendly to the project.

Drake and Future recently performed music off of this project when they did a show in Austin. While they are still enjoying this, fans are not buying the project the way they were. What A Time To Be Alive saw sales drop 81% down to 65,000 copies in its second week.
